A Celestial Journey Through Heartache: Brennan Savage's 'Junkyard'

Brennan Savage's song 'Junkyard' is a poignant exploration of love, loss, and the quest for self-discovery. The lyrics paint a vivid picture of a person grappling with the aftermath of a broken relationship. The recurring imagery of being sent through the stars and traveling on a rocket ship to Mars symbolizes a desire to escape the pain and confusion of the earthly realm. This celestial journey represents a search for solace and a place where the protagonist can find peace, away from the emotional turmoil caused by the separation.

The song delves into the emotional impact of the breakup, highlighting the protagonist's struggle to come to terms with the lies and deceit that characterized the relationship. The lines 'I lost my mind when you said bye to me' and 'I could tell every time that you lied to me' reflect the deep sense of betrayal and the difficulty in moving on. Despite the pain, there is a glimmer of hope as the protagonist expresses a desire to find themselves and free their mind, even though peace remains elusive.

The haunting imagery of walking alone at night with 'demons in my eyes' underscores the internal battle the protagonist faces. The song captures the essence of feeling lost and the desperate need for change, as well as the lengths one might go to make a loved one feel alive again. The repeated refrain of not returning home unless reunited with the loved one emphasizes the depth of the emotional connection and the longing for reconciliation. 'Junkyard' is a raw and introspective piece that resonates with anyone who has experienced the complexities of love and loss.
